- OPERATIONS: Operate and maintain a variety of water treatment and distribution system equipment, including pumps, motors, filtration systems, chemical feed systems, and water quality analyzers. Utilize SCADA to monitor system performance and make/recommend process adjustments as needed. Serve as backup treatment Operator in Responsible Charge (ORC) as needed.
- TECHNICAL EXPERTISE: Serve as a technical resource for water treatment facility operations, including process optimization at the membrane filtration and conventional treatment facilities. Design and conduct pilot studies and jar tests to improve system performance. Continuously monitor, troubleshoot, and evaluate technical performance of equipment and processes pertaining to water treatment and the distribution system.
- REGULATORY COMPLIANCE: Oversee monitoring and regulatory compliance programs; Ensure compliance with the federal Safe Drinking Water Act and all rules within Colorado Regulation 11. Maintain accurate records and reports to support compliance and process optimization efforts.
- PROJECT MANAGEMENT: Advises on design, construction, and startup of capital improvement projects pertaining to water treatment and the distribution system; plan, schedule, coordinate, and manage associated projects. Collects and reports data to inform data-driven decisions in the project design phase.
- DISTRIBUTION SYSTEM MANAGEMENT: Support the operation of the water distribution system, including implementation of flow control strategies, and coordination with operational teams for repairs and maintenance.
- PROGRAM MANAGEMENT: Lead the Partnership for Safe Water program, ensuring best practices in reporting, optimization, and treatment performance.
- MAINTENANCE: Perform preventative and corrective maintenance on treatment and distribution equipment. Coordinate with supervisors and engineering teams on equipment replacements and capital improvement projects.
